    Dr. Thea Kano came on as the surprising choice for Artistic Director of the Gay Men's Chorus of Washington 21 years ago. The conversation highlights the important role that music and the arts play in turbulent times and how the chorus lives out their mission to promote equality, achieve justice, and overcome our differences.

    Allison Thompson certainly knows how to keep about a dozen balls in the air at once. As the Convention Manager for Harmony, Inc., Allison is the driving force behind the annual International Convention & Contest. This year, she's also stepped up to help with the organization's expansion efforts and is leading the team for Harmony Fest West. Hear more about the upcoming events and gain a little insight on what goes into pulling off stellar large-scale events!

    Rachel Tedder chased a dream and found herself in Germany where she has performed in a variety of setting for over a decade. The founder of OperAcappella, The Poperettes, and The Christmas Carollers, Rachel has also immersed herself in the European vocal music community and is diving head first into the concept of vocal painting.
